How To Choose The Best Grow Light For Poinsettia

Poinsettias are photoperiodic short-day plants, meaning they require long, uninterrupted nights (about 14 hours) to trigger bract formation. But when the lights are on, they demand high light intensity—at least 2000 foot-candles (roughly 200 µmol/m²/s PPFD) at canopy level—to maintain leaf health and deep color. A light that is too weak produces pale, stretched growth, while a light too close can burn the upper leaves. Understanding the specs below will help you pick the fixture that matches your specific growing setup.

Full-Spectrum Output and Red Wavelengths

A basic white LED panel improves growth, but poinsettias respond strongly to deep-red light around 660 nm for bract pigmentation and to blue light around 450 nm for compact leaf structure. Look for fixtures that explicitly list red and blue diodes or a full-spectrum Kelvin close to 5000K–6500K with added 660nm red. Adjustable Timer and Dimmability

Because poinsettias require strict dark periods, a built-in timer that can run 12-to-16-hour on cycles is essential. The fixture must hold the schedule reliably through mains power interruptions. Dimmability adds further control, letting you reduce intensity during the initial recovery period after transplant or ramp up during peak bract development without moving the light arm.

Coverage Pattern and Mounting Flexibility

A single standard poinsettia in a 6-to-8-inch pot needs a focused cone of light roughly 12 to 18 inches in diameter at 12 inches above the canopy. Hardware & Specs Guide

PPFD and Lumens

Poinsettias need a PPFD of roughly 150–200 µmol/m²/s at bract level for good color development. Lumen ratings give you a rough proxy: 1000 lumens at 12 inches provides roughly 100 µmol/m²/s for a standard 18-inch coverage area. The FECiDA at 2000 lumens delivers approximately double that baseline, while the White Halo 3-pack at lower wattage provides maintenance-level light. Always check the light spread—a narrow beam concentrates PAR into a small spot, which can overexpose the center bracts while starving the periphery.

FAQ

How many hours should a poinsettia grow light run each day?
During the vegetative growth phase, run the light 14–16 hours per day. When forcing bracts for the holiday season, you need 14 hours of *uninterrupted darkness* per night, so the grow light should be on for a maximum of 10 hours during that period. Use a timer (6/12/16H mode on most fixtures) to automate the on/off cycle consistently.
Can I use a regular LED bulb instead of a grow light for my poinsettia?
A standard daylight LED bulb (5000K–6500K) will keep a poinsettia alive and support basic photosynthesis, but it lacks the deep-red 660nm wavelengths needed for optimal bract pigmentation. For sturdy leaf growth, a regular bulb works; for show-worthy red bracts, a full-spectrum grow light with red diodes is strongly recommended.
How far should I place the grow light from the poinsettia canopy?
For most clip-on and tabletop fixtures, an 8–12 inch distance from the topmost bracts is the sweet spot. Closer than 6 inches can cause leaf-edge burn, especially with high-lumen panels like the FECiDA. Farther than 14 inches reduces PPFD below the effective threshold for color development. Adjust based on whether your fixture has dimming capability—lower brightness allows closer placement safely.
